Product Overview
785nm Raman Spectroscopy Laser | 100mW Wavelock™ Stabilized Laser Diode Module
The WAVELOCK™ series laser diode modules are stabilized using a VHG, volume holographic grating. The WAVELOCK™ VHG provides exceptional wavelength stability and a narrowed spectral bandwidth for the most demanding Raman spectroscopy and analytical instrumentation applications. The volume holographic grating functions as an external cavity that locks the laser diode’s wavelength and provides a narrow emission output. The PowerController low noise current source has been optimized to provide the highest levels of power stability.

Turn-Key System with Controller Unit and Software
The Lambda Beam WAVELOCK™ VHG laser head requires a laser controller to provide power and control all operating parameters; this model includes the PowerController module with the L-Tune GUI control software. (For scientific applications and prototyping we recommend using our PowerController. For industrial integration we also offer the highly compact PowerBox to be directly attached to the laser head or connected via a customized cable.)
